What you'll do
- Architect and deploy AI-driven sales tools such as HubSpot Prospecting Agents, custom Gemini Gems, and Sales Coach bots to automate and enhance seller effectiveness.
- Build, train, and maintain AI-driven digital sales training guides and internal resources that standardize best practices and improve team performance.
- Design and implement advanced data enrichment and automated scraping pipelines for conference apps, web-based membership lists, and XML feeds from sources such as ProPublica, ensuring seamless auto-updates to HubSpot or central databases.
- Own outbound automation infrastructure configuration and execution using platforms like RB2B, Instantly, or custom in-house equivalents, supported by tools like BuiltWith, LinkedIn Sales Navigator, and Clay.
- Build, clean, and enrich highly targeted prospect lists through consultative analysis of data sources and automation workflows.
- Design and execute integration partner workflows, identifying platform users, injecting them as clean records into the CRM, and appending Nonprofit Software data to trigger automated outreach.
- Serve as the primary technical administrator for HubSpot, optimizing lead routing logic, building custom lead-scanner applications for conferences, managing complex data hygiene, and eliminating operational bottlenecks.
- Develop lead-scanner applications tailored for conference environments to enable real-time data capture and immediate follow-up.
- Create advanced dashboards tracking conversion rates, response times, and pipeline health to provide actionable insights for strategic decisions.
- Write comprehensive systems documentation and standard operating procedures to ensure clarity, continuity, and ease of replication for all technical solutions.
- Collaborate with global team members across the US and the Philippines to align technical implementations with evolving sales objectives and market needs.
- Continuously refine existing automations and AI workflows to improve accuracy, speed, and reliability of sales operations, ensuring best-in-class performance.
Requirements
- Based in the Philippines with consistent availability for a long-term, full-time work-from-home role.
- 3-6+ years of experience in Sales Operations, RevOps, or Systems Engineering within a B2B SaaS or corporate environment; this is not an entry-level position.
- Advanced proficiency with HubSpot, Make.com, Clay, Zapier, or similar middleware automation platforms to design and maintain complex integrations.
- Demonstrated ability to handle "hard builds," including XML and JSON data scraping, web scraping, and manipulation of API webhooks to connect disparate systems.
- Direct experience building, deploying, and customizing AI agents and LLMs for business logic and sales applications, including prompt engineering for practical use cases.
- A consultative mindset capable of transforming loose operational problems into technical blueprints and delivering polished, finished products independently.
- Strict adherence to US EST working hours (approximately 8 or 9 am to 5 or 6 pm EST) while working remotely.
- Commitment to a mission-driven environment where work directly supports organizations dedicated to creating positive social impact.
